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Pulborough to Seaton Carew start from as little as £58.40

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Pulborough to Seaton Carew start from £100.80 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Pulborough to Seaton Carew are available for £204.50 one way

Pulborough Station Amenities and Facilities

Pulborough boasts a range of facilities focused on convenience and accessibility. The station has a fully operational ticket office opening as early as 06:00 AM on weekdays, and ticket machines are available for those who prefer speedy self-service. For tech-friendly travelers, smartcard issuers and validators are provided, though it's worth noting that public Wi-Fi is not available.

Access is a paramount consideration at Pulborough. It offers step-free access to platform 2 via a side entrance with a short but steep ramp. Accessible ticket machines are present, accommodating travelers using Disabled Persons Railcard. However, for assistance, do check here for more details about accessibility facilities.

Station Facilities and Accessibility

Seaton Carew station is equipped with user-friendly ticket machines for collecting pre-purchased tickets, as there is no ticket office on-site. For those with accessibility needs, the station offers step-free access, making it easy for wheelchair users to navigate. However, it's worth noting that the station doesn’t have tactile pavings and lacks amenities like waiting rooms, toilets, and refreshment facilities.

While the station operates without on-site staff, help is available through a helpline. Passengers needing assistance can utilize the Passenger Assist services, which can also be booked in advance, ensuring stress-free travel for all.

Onward Travel Options

Getting to and from Seaton Carew is largely facilitated by taxis, with services easily accessible online. Though there are no immediate local bus services near the station, rail replacement services are available, with pickups just 100 yards from the railway bridge. If you're keen on cycling, do plan accordingly as there are currently no bicycle storage facilities offered on-site.
